BLACK BEAN SOUP
Page 87
Recipe makes 1 gallon.
1 cup black beans
2 medium onions, diced
2 tsp. garlic, chopped
10 plum tomatoes, roughly chopped
2 cups bacon, diced
1 bay leaf
1 jalapeño, chopped
1 gallon chicken stock
Salt
Pepper
1 bottle dark beer
In a soup pot, combine all of the ingredients except the dark beer. Bring the stock to boil. Cover and simmer over low heat until beans are tender, approximately 3 hours.
Just before serving, add beer and bring to near boil for 3 minutes until alcohol evaporates.
Garnish with any of the following:
1 red onion, diced
1 tsp. lime juice
1 tsp. minced jalapeño
1 large bunch cilantro, chopped
Mix and salt and pepper to taste. Optional: Add a small dollop of non-fat yogurt.
